About 3-phenylazetidine;triethoxysilane
3-phenylazetidine;triethoxysilane (PubChem CID 173466257) has the molecular formula C15H27NO3Si
and a molecular weight of 297.47 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is 3-phenylazetidine;triethoxysilane.
